Key Terms and Glossary for Rideshare Accident Cases

Understanding specialized legal terms can help clients better grasp their case details. Below are definitions of frequently used terms related to rideshare accident claims in Patterson.

Rideshare Driver Insurance

Insurance coverage maintained by the individual driver providing rideshare services. This insurance may have limits and conditions that differ from personal auto policies, often activating only when the driver is actively working on the rideshare platform.

Third-Party Liability

Responsibility assigned to a party other than the insured driver, typically the other driver involved in the accident or the rideshare company, for causing damages or injuries in a collision.

Rideshare Company Insurance

Insurance policies held by the rideshare company that cover drivers and passengers under certain conditions, such as when the driver is en route to pick up a passenger or actively transporting one.

Comparative Negligence

A legal principle that may reduce the compensation a claimant receives if they are found partially at fault for the accident. The compensation is adjusted based on the percentage of fault assigned to each party.

Tips for Navigating Rideshare Accident Claims

Document the Scene Thoroughly

If you are involved in a rideshare accident, take photos of the scene, vehicle damage, and any visible injuries. Collect contact information from all parties and witnesses. This documentation is critical for supporting your claim and establishing the facts.

Seek Medical Attention Promptly

Even if injuries seem minor, it is important to get a medical evaluation as soon as possible. Some injuries may not be immediately apparent but can have serious consequences if left untreated. Medical records also provide essential evidence for your claim.

Communicate Carefully with Insurance Companies

Be cautious when speaking to insurance adjusters. Provide factual information but avoid making statements that could be used to minimize your claim. It is often advisable to consult with legal counsel before giving detailed information to insurers.

Liability in a rideshare accident can be complex as it may involve the rideshare driver, the rideshare company, or other drivers involved in the collision. Determining fault requires a thorough investigation of the circumstances surrounding the accident. California laws and rideshare company policies also influence liability. Analyzing all factors helps identify responsible parties to pursue appropriate claims.

In California,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ims, including those from rideshare accidents, is generally two years from the date of the accident. It is important to initiate your claim within this period to preserve your legal rights. Waiting too long can result in losing the ability to seek compensation, so timely consultation with legal counsel is recommended.

Rideshare drivers typically have personal insurance policies that may not cover accidents while driving for a rideshare service. The rideshare company carries supplemental insurance during specific periods, such as when the driver is en route to pick up or transporting a passenger. Understanding these coverage layers is important to determine claim options.

If the rideshare driver is uninsured or underinsured, you may be able to make a claim through your own insurance policy if you have uninsured/underinsured motorist coverage. Additionally, legal avenues may exist to pursue compensation from other liable parties. Consulting with a legal professional can provide guidance tailored to your situation.
